今天有个刚入行的小兄弟问我。
他说哥,我想做个酷炫的官网。
问我要不要学Flash。
我差点把刚喝进去的咖啡喷出来。
这都2024年了,谁还学那老古董?
这问题问得,就像问我要不要买马车去送外卖。
真是让人哭笑不得。
先说结论。
网站建设为什么学flash?
答案只有一个:为了让你早点认清现实。
或者,为了让你去修那些十年前的老破小网站。
现在的浏览器,Chrome、Edge、Safari。
哪个还支持Flash?
根本不支持。
连个插件都装不上。
你花半年时间学会做动画。
最后做出来的东西,用户打不开。
这就是最大的笑话。
我当年刚入行那会儿。
确实见过不少用Flash做的网站。
那是2010年左右的事。
那时候觉得真牛掰。
鼠标动一下,页面跟着转。
点开一个按钮,整个屏幕炸开烟花。
视觉效果拉满。
但是呢?
SEO?不存在的。
搜索引擎根本爬不到里面的内容。
用户想看个新闻,得先等加载。
加载完了,还得点一下才能看。
体验极差。
我记得有个客户,非要搞个全屏Flash导航。
结果手机用户打开,直接黑屏。
他在电话里骂了我半小时。
我也很委屈啊。
我说这是技术限制。
他说你不懂用户体验。
其实他是被甲方逼的。
甲方觉得这样才显得“高科技”。
这种甲方,现在估计都倒闭了。
再说个真实的案例。
前年有个老同事,接了个私活。
客户是个传统制造业老板。
非要还原他2008年的官网风格。
说是“经典怀旧”。
老同事心软,真去学了点ActionScript。
折腾了两周。
最后交付那天,老板看了一眼。
说:“这啥啊?怎么转不动?”
老同事解释说是HTML5重做的。
老板说:“不对啊,我记忆里是Flash。”
最后老同事赔了钱。
因为代码写得烂,兼容性问题一堆。
这教训还不够深刻吗?
网站建设为什么学flash?
除非你想怀旧,或者你想修旧如旧。
否则,别碰。
现在的网页技术,HTML5、CSS3、JavaScript。
这三个才是亲儿子。
HTML5能做动画。
CSS3能做特效。
JS能交互。
而且速度快,兼容好,对SEO友好。
你花同样的时间学这些。
做出来的东西,用户爱看,老板满意,搜索引擎喜欢。
这才是正道。
别在那纠结什么“复古风”。
现在的复古,是UI设计上的复古。
不是技术栈上的复古。
你搞个像素风的按钮,那是审美。
你搞个Flash的播放器,那是事故。
我也不是完全否定Flash。
它在历史上立过功。
它让网页变得生动。
它启发了后来的Canvas和WebGL。
但是时代变了。
就像诺基亚,再经典也得退场。
你还抱着它打电话,只能摔断腿。
现在的开发者,精力有限。
要把时间花在刀刃上。
学Vue、React、Node.js。
这些才是吃饭的家伙。
学Flash?
那是自废武功。
如果你看到现在还有人推荐你学Flash。
直接拉黑他。
他不是不懂,就是坏。
他想割韭菜。
或者他自己是老古董,跟不上时代。
网站建设为什么学flash?
这个问题本身就是一个陷阱。
它让你把时间浪费在过时的技术上。
让你产生一种“我很努力”的错觉。
其实你只是在原地踏步。
甚至是在倒退。
我见过太多年轻人。
因为学错了方向,两年没找到好工作。
简历上写着精通Flash。
HR看一眼,直接扔垃圾桶。
因为没人招这个。
市场早就淘汰了。
你再去学,就是跟市场对着干。
除非你去博物馆当讲解员。
或者去修那些还没拆掉的旧网站。
但那种机会,少得可怜。
而且钱少事多。
不划算。
所以,听我一句劝。
别在Flash上浪费生命。
去学点新的。
去学点能落地的。
去学点用户真正需要的。
网站建设,核心是内容和服务。
不是炫技。
Flash只能炫技。
而且炫得让人想吐。
现在的网页,要快,要稳,要好看。
还要好维护。
Flash哪样都不占。
除了“难维护”这一项,它是专业的。
最后再说一句。
如果你真的对动画感兴趣。
去学Lottie。
去学GSAP。
去学Three.js。
这些才是现代网页动画的正确打开方式。
它们基于Web标准。
它们性能更好。
它们不会被淘汰。
别回头看了。
前面的路还长。
别背着Flash这个包袱。
跑不快。